Your Canon EOS Rebel T6/1300D offers major photography power along with tools to get pro-level images without pro-level know-how. This book helps you navigate your camera's settings and apply proven photography techniques for getting better portraits, close-ups, landscapes, and action shots. Inside… A tour of your camera's controls How to shoot in Live View Adjusting exposure settings Getting more colorful images When to use flash Tips for better portraits Sharing your photos Read more About the Author Julie Adair King is a veteran digital photography author and educator whose books are industry bestsellers. She is author of Digital Photography For Dummies as well as thirty books on Canon and Nikon cameras. Her books have sold more than a million copies. Read more
